Japan Side Costs
Car Price (Listing / Auction)
The price shown on the listing in USD
Enter listing price above
Japan Consumption Tax (10%)
Applied to auction purchases — may be included in listed price
Auto-calculated at 10%
Exporter / Broker Commission
Fee paid to Japan-side exporter or broker
Typical range: $500 – $1,500
Pre-Purchase Inspection (Japan)
Third-party physical inspection before purchase
Always recommended — $150 – $300

Shipping & Insurance
Ocean Freight (Japan → US Port)
RoRo or container shipping
West Coast: $1,200–$1,500 / East Coast: $1,500–$1,800
East Coast Panama Transfer Surcharge
Applies if destination is Baltimore, NJ, or East Coast ports
Off
+$90 if East Coast port
Marine Insurance
Strongly recommended — protects against loss/damage in transit
On — $70
Always recommend this to clients

US Side Costs
US Customs Duty (2.5%)
Applies to 25-year+ exempt vehicles — confirm with customs broker
Auto-calculated at 2.5% of car price
Customs Broker Fee
US-side broker handles customs clearance paperwork
Typical range: $300 – $500
Port Handling & Storage Fees
Port release, processing, and any storage while clearing customs
Typical range: $300 – $500
Inland Transport (Port → Client)
Trucking or transport from port to client's location
Varies by distance — $300 – $800

Post-Arrival Budget
US Mechanic Inspection on Arrival
Recommended even after Japan inspection
$150 – $300
Immediate Maintenance Budget
Fluids, belts, seals — expected on any 20-25yr old car
Rotary engines: budget $2,000 – $5,000
State Registration & Title Transfer
Varies by state
Florida: ~$200 – $400
